Community Description

Hawkstone in Sarasota offers new single-family homes just off State Road 72, a few minutes from I-75 and close to Downtown Sarasota, Lakewood Ranch, and the Gulf Coast's renowned beaches. Its location also provides convenient access to the highly rated Skye Ranch K-8 District and Riverview High School.The community features flexible floorplans with open living areas, modern kitchens, private owner's suites, and options for personalized design. Spacious homesites and thoughtful layouts create comfortable spaces that adapt to your daily routine.Residents enjoy a quiet setting with easy access to parks, nature preserves, cultural attractions, and a wide variety of dining and shopping. Hawkstone offers a relaxed Sarasota lifestyle with the convenience of nearby amenities and the charm of Florida's Gulf Coast.
